Mick Dyson Memorial Competiton this weekend

Mick Dyson was a popular member of Almondbury BC and captain of their Huddersfield League team when he passed away on Christmas Day 2020. This new competition is to commemorate Mick's contribution to his club and to raise funds for the Motor Neurone Disease appeal. It has been put together by the Dyson family along with the club and will be staged over Saturday 18th and Sunday 19th which is this coming weekend. As of yesterday, there were still a few places open to complete the 64 bowler competition and all the details are listed below.


There will be four sessions on Saturday at 10.30am, 12.30pm, 2.30pm and 4.30pm with 16 players in each session, win one game and return Sunday for the finals. Spectators will be very welcome on both days and lots for the visitors to get involved in as well as watching some competitive bowling.
